Anbernic handhelds are ready-made retro consoles: screen, controls and battery built in — just insert a microSD card flashed with Recalbox. Here are the models supported by Recalbox 10.1.

All these consoles share the Rockchip RK3566 SoC (4 × Cortex-A55 cores at 1.8 GHz, Mali-G52 GPU) and the same Recalbox image, with automatic model detection:
| Console | Screen | Highlights |
|---|---|---|
| RG353M | 3.5" 640×480 | The only model tested by the team |
Other consoles built on the same SoC — the other RG353 models, the RG503, the RG Arc, and some Powkiddy handhelds — have not been tested. An identical chip is not enough: every machine has its own boot chain, and that is usually where things break. The team even had to redo the work between two revisions of a single RG353M. Those models may work; we cannot guarantee anything.
Connectivity (depending on the model): built-in 2.4/5 GHz Wi-Fi and Bluetooth, mini-HDMI output to play on the TV, two microSD slots, USB-C.
On models sold with Android (P, V, M), Recalbox boots from the microSD card: the Android system installed internally is left untouched. The "S" variants (PS, VS), which ship without Android, work the same way.

The RG351 handhelds use the Rockchip RK3326 SoC (4 × Cortex-A55 cores at 1.5 GHz, Mali-G31 GPU) — the same chip as the Odroid Go Advance. They are supported by the Odroid Go Advance / Go Super image, with model detection at boot:
| Console | Screen | Highlights |
|---|---|---|
| RG351V | 3.5" 640×480 | Vertical layout, built-in Wi-Fi — the only model tested |

Sleep mode, battery management and returning to the frontend all work from the console's buttons; over HDMI (RG353/RG503), the console displays on your TV.
Models built on other chips (RG35XX, RG405, RG556…) are not supported: the Recalbox images do not cover those processors.
